Post 后处理模块
格式支持:HyperWorks 的流体求解器 AcuSolve/ nanoFluidX/ ultraFluidX/ ElectroFlo
可通过ENSIGHT格式读取第三方流体求解器的结果
支持流动噪声信号处理
流线,矢量图,云图,等值面图,XY Plot图,积分工具,探针工具,自定义表达式
支持后台批量执行后处理脚本,自动输出图片,生成PPT报告
Post 主界面
界面风格和HyperMesh类似,左侧模型树管理部件和用户自定义项目。
PostBrowser
支持同时导入多个结果文件,通过在模型树右键Make Current切换。
导入多个结果
模型树分类管理
Reader Options读入选项
用户在导入结果文件的时候,可以勾选Q-Criterion/ Lamda2/ Vorticity变量,常用于涡结构的显示。
导入UltraFluidX的选项
导入AcuSolve的选项
State 状态文件
用户可以通过File→State→Save State将后处理的状态保存为*cpstate文件,方便下次查看。
当导入另外一个计算工况文件的时候,可以在模型树右键选择Apply State,导入上次保存的状态文件,应用到当前结果文件,方便比较模型。
示例:Apply State
导入第一个模型,定义各种后处理显示。导入第二个模型,并应用state文件,立刻比较两种不同湍流模型的结果差异。
Post 工具栏说明
工具栏基本分为三类:Visualize显示功能/ Measure测量功能/ Aereoacoustic声学后处理。
Visualize
Measure
Boundary Groups
汽车乘员舱内表面温度
Slice Planes
交互式创建切面,切面可以旋转和移动。
示例:用Slice工具交互式创建切面
切面显示的不同方式:
Slice Plane
Vectors
Contour Lines
Grid Display
Outlines
Warp切面的物理量用凹凸形态体现
Transparency透明度控制
速度矢量显示的控制:
Vector length箭头长度比例缩放,或等长度
Vector component 投影矢量或三维矢量
Subset控制矢量显示的稀疏程度
Finite slice控制切面的范围,默认是贯穿整个模型
Crinkle slice控制切面是投影平面还是网格凹凸面
示例: 颗粒追踪显示
Iso-Surface
等值面是基于体数据,因此先在Solids选择计算域,Iso-function选择变量名称。创建的等值面可以用变量值着色显示。
示例:风扇出口涡量等值面
示例:矩形管路内流Q_Criterion等值面
示例:汽车外流场x-velocity=0m/s等值面
示例:空间流线从等值面生长
Streamlines
三维流线有5种创建方式,分别是矩形面,线段,圆面,点,面。
从自定义矩形面位置生长流线
从自定义圆面位置生长流线
从Rake线段生长流线
示例:阀门空间流线动画
Rake流线生成后,在模型树右键点击,选择Animate预览动画效果,通过File→Screen Capture→Video to File保存动画。
示例:压缩机空间流线动画
示例:三维流线动画
Growing Streamlines
Finite mass particles
Traveling Vectors
Streamline (Steady) Animation
Traveling Vectors
Time-dependent Animation
Surface Streamlines
表面流线可以从壁面,切面,等值面生长。
风力机叶片表面流线
示例:乘员舱表面流线
先创建温度ISO等值面,再从等值面上创建表面流线。显示出特定温度区域的流动细节。
示例:管路表面流线
从固体壁面创建表面流线:
表面流线打开Vector显示,用wall shear stress着色,点击Animate预览动画效果(稳态结果也可以动画)。
类似的方法,先创建切面,再从切面生成表面流线,通过seeds的数量控制流线疏密。
类似的方法,先创建等值面,再从等值面生成表面流线。这里的等值面是马赫数1,表面流线显示出阀门下游跨音速区域的流动细节。
本期的HyperMesh CFD 功能详解:后处理功能分享就到这里啦,下一期我们还将继续介绍更多后处理相关的内容。